One spring day, Henry noted the time of day and the temperature, in degrees Fahrenheit. His findings are as follows: At 6 a. m., the temperature was 50° F. For the next 2 hours, the temperature rose 2° per hour. For the next 4 hours, it rose 4° per hour. The temperature then stayed steady until 6 p. m. For the next 3 hours, the temperature dropped 1° per hour. The temperature then dropped steadily until the temperature was 62° at midnight. On the set of axes below, graph Henry's data.
